More off-topic: Amtrak locomotive number 4,
which was at the end of the train taking Republicans to the
Greenbrier last week, was the second unit on northbound
Amtrak train 20 Thursday morning. I saw it from the Braddock
Road Metrorail stop. Being at the rear, it sustained no
damage in the collision. Amtrak 20 left Alexandria 24
minutes early Thursday. Yes, early. If you still have your
paper timetables, you can read in the fine print,
"Stops only to discharge passengers; train may leave
before time shown."
